3 Famous people with this name?
- Percival Lowell - A famed astronomer who thought he found canals on Mars. I t's science, people.
- Percival "Percy" Blakeney - The main character in "The Scarlet Pimpernel." Historical hero vibes? Check!
- Percival Graves - A fictional wizard from “Fantastic Beasts.” Because your little one has to love magic, right?
What is the history of the name?
Percival has legendary roots, so worn that King Arthur himself might have stubbed his toe on them. First popping up in Arthurian legends as one of the Knights of the Round Table, Percival has a story as rich as chocolate cake.
What does the name mean?
Percival means "pierce the valley." Arm your child with this name, and they’ll be metaphorically cutting through life’s BS with the grace of a knight in (socially responsible) shining armor.

3 Famous people with this name?
- Seraphina Affleck - The adorable celeb kiddo of Jennifer Garner and Ben Affleck.
- Seraphina Picquery - Another "Fantastic Be asts" reference! The President of MACUSA.
- Saint Seraphina - A charming medieval Italian saint, bringing holiness to your household.
What is the history of the name?
Seraphina's story is as heavenly as it sounds. A name woven with celestial threads, it’s tied to seraphim, angelic beings known in ancient Judeo-Christian lore. Thus, this name is aimed at parents with head-in-the-clouds, but boots-on-the-ground aspirations.
What does the name mean?
Boasting a meaning of "fiery" or "ardent," donning the name Seraphina means dressing your little cherub in irresistible charm, fierce love, and an insatiable spirit.
